The yolk sac (YS) is the primary source of exchange between the embryo and mother before the placental circulation is established. It first appears at about 5 weeks gestation and is visualized by ultrasound when the mean gestational sac diameter exceeds 8 to 13 mm The yolk sac growth is linear to a maximum of 6 mm and it is never >6 mm in normal pregnancies at 10 weeks gestation (Fig. Yolk sac is the first anatomical structure identified within the gestational sac. A yolk sac can be detected easily by transvaginal sonogra-phy when the mean gestational sac diameter is 5 to 6 mm. The yolk sac is a membranous sac attached to an embryo, formed by cells of the hypoblast adjacent to the embryonic disk.This is alternatively called the umbilical vesicle by the Terminologia Embryologica (TE), though yolk sac is far more widely used.
